NOV. 28TH. - TYNEMOUTH, NORTHUMBERLAND.
An unknown vessel had been reported making distress signals, but nothing could be found. - Rewards, £16 6s. 6d..
DECEMBER 23RD. - LYTHAM - ST. ANNES, LANCASHIRE. It was reported that an unknown vessel was sinking and that twoboats with four men in each had left her, but nothing was found. - Rewards, £15 19s..

OCT. 4TII. - BLYTH, NORTHUMBERLAND.
A motor fishing boat had shown distress signals, but was towed in by a tug.
- Reward, £6 7s. 6d..
